Transaction d575f72f49234f69c2ecd1a4523e328f29c8234cb4f17976c867890e138d6728

1 Input
1 Outputs
  • d575f72f49234f69c2ecd1a4523e328f29c8234cb4f17976c867890e138d6728:0
  • value  1105846860
    address  1E4mnBL8DiTMSep1VXyhpgWUujGQArLeLw